A KEY member of Morton's first-team squad has committed to a new contract with the Cappielow side - extending his five-year stay in Greenock.

Midfielder Cameron Blues has put pen to paper on a two-year deal to remain with Dougie Imrie's men until 2026.

The 26-year-old joined the Ton back in 2019 and has gone on to make more than 150 appearances, with the new deal taking Blues into his seventh year with the club.

A mainstay in the starting line-up, Blues made 47 appearances last season, scoring twice and playing an important part in the team's memorable run to the quarter-finals of the Scottish Cup, as well as progression in the League Cup and a fifth place finish in the Championship.

The announcement will come as a welcome boost for fans ahead of the opening of the summer transfer window and the potential departure of several stars.

League rivals Partick Thistle last night confirmed the pre-contract signing of Robbie Crawford, while Ayr United have reportedly registered an interest in taking forward George Oakley, and top scorer Robbie Muirhead has joined Livingston.

Contracts for Calum Waters, Jai Quitongo, Lewis McGrattan, Alan Power and Jamie MacDonald were not renewed, with talks ongoing with Kirk Broadfoot, club captain Grant Gillespie, wideman Michael Garrity, centre half Darragh O'Connor.

The Tele revealed last week how left back Lewis Strapp looks poised to leave after being offered reduced terms.

Incoming Welsh goalscorer Jordan Davies will join the Ton's other current contracted players for the 2024/25 season: Ryan Mullen, Iain Wilson, Logan O’Boy, Jack Baird, Alexander King and Jack Bearne.
